titleOfInvention | Exon 44-targeted nucleic acids and recombinant adeno-associated virus comprising said nucleic acids for treatment of dystrophin-based myopathies |
abstract | The disclosure relates to the field of gene therapy for the treatment of a muscular dystrophy including, but not limited to, Duchenne Muscular Dystrophy (DMD). More particularly, the disclosure provides nucleic acids, including nucleic acids encoding U7-based small nuclear ribonucleic acids (RNAs) (snRNAs), U7-based snRNAs, and recombinant adeno-associated virus (rAAV) comprising the nucleic acid molecules to deliver nucleic acids encoding U7-based snRNAs to induce exon-skipping for use in treating a muscular dystrophy including, but not limited to, DMD, resulting from a mutation amenable to skipping exon 44 of the DMD gene (DMD exon 44) including, but not limited to, any mutation involving, surrounding, or affecting DMD exon 44. |
